首页 后端开发 Python教程 Python实现的快速Web应用程序开发(RAD)

Python实现的快速Web应用程序开发(RAD)

Jun 17, 2023 pm 12:25 PM
python web开发 rad

Python实现的快速Web应用程序开发(RAD)

在当今快节奏的商业世界中,Web应用程序的开发需要快速而且高效。当前,Python已经成为了其中最流行的语言之一。Python的强大功能以及易学习的特性吸引了众多的开发者。Python能够帮助开发者轻松快速地完成Web应用程序的开发,这得益于Python强劲的Web框架。

Python的框架:

Python的框架包括Flask,Pyramid,Django,Bottle等。

Flask: Flask是一个极为流行的Python Web框架。Flask的特点是灵活,轻量,可扩展。Flask没有特定的项目布局要求,因此可以让开发者在开发过程中进行自由程度更高的控制。

Pyramid: Pyramid是一个功能强大的Python Web框架。它提供了多种选项,这些选项可让开发者按照自己的需求来使用。Pyramid提供了强大的开发工具,如内置的权限管理和安全性管理。Pyramid目前已经成为了许多大公司所使用的Web框架之一。

Django: Django是一个功能强大的框架,它被广泛应用于大型Web应用的开发。Django 具备完整的功能, 包括ORM、自动管理用户会话、安全管理、内置的模板引擎和各种数据库引擎的管理。Django非常适合新手和中级开发者。

Bottle: Bottle是一个简单易用的Python Web框架。与其他框架相比,Bottle更加灵活且易于学习。Bottle内置了一个简单但功能强大的模板引擎。其资源占用率也非常小,适合于小型应用。Bottle支持多线程和WebSocket,并且可以很方便的部署到云平台上。

通过使用这些框架,Python可以帮助开发者大大提高开发效率以及代码的可读性。

快速Web应用程序开发(RAD):

快速Web应用程序开发是指在快速迭代的过程中开发应用程序。这种方法可以大大减少开发时间,并且能够提高开发人员之间的沟通和协作。

Python的高效性使其成为了实现RAD(快速应用程序开发)的理想选择。Python具有简洁的语法和丰富的良好设计的库,这些都使得Python在搭建站点、搭建API、数据处理和野外到生产等方面具有优势。

Python的RAD(快速应用程序开发)使得开发过程更加协调和高效。Python可以通过使用现成的库和框架来搭建可复用的组件,从而将开发时间大大缩短。

Python可以帮助开发者以更加高效的方式构建Web应用程序,从而获得成功。Python提供了一些卓越的开发工具和文档,可以帮助开发者更快捷地开发高质量的Web应用程序。这使得Python成为了最好的解决方案之一,不论是初学者还是资深的程序员。如果您正在考虑开发一个Web app,不要犹豫,使用Python吧!

以上是Python实现的快速Web应用程序开发(RAD)的详细内容。更多信息请关注PHP中文网其他相关文章!

本站声明
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n

热AI工具

Undresser.AI Undress

Undresser.AI Undress

人工智能驱动的应用程序,用于创建逼真的裸体照片

AI Clothes Remover

AI Clothes Remover

用于从照片中去除衣服的在线人工智能工具。

Undress AI Tool

Undress AI Tool

免费脱衣服图片

Clothoff.io

Clothoff.io

AI脱衣机

AI Hentai Generator

AI Hentai Generator

免费生成ai无尽的。

热门文章

R.E.P.O.能量晶体解释及其做什么(黄色晶体)
2 周前 By 尊渡假赌尊渡假赌尊渡假赌
仓库:如何复兴队友
4 周前 By 尊渡假赌尊渡假赌尊渡假赌
Hello Kitty Island冒险:如何获得巨型种子
4 周前 By 尊渡假赌尊渡假赌尊渡假赌

热工具

记事本++7.3.1

记事本++7.3.1

好用且免费的代码编辑器

SublimeText3汉化版

SublimeText3汉化版

中文版,非常好用

禅工作室 13.0.1

禅工作室 13.0.1

功能强大的PHP集成开发环境

Dreamweaver CS6

Dreamweaver CS6

视觉化网页开发工具

SublimeText3 Mac版

SublimeText3 Mac版

神级代码编辑软件(SublimeText3)

如何解决Linux终端中查看Python版本时遇到的权限问题? 如何解决Linux终端中查看Python版本时遇到的权限问题? Apr 01, 2025 pm 05:09 PM

Linux终端中查看Python版本时遇到权限问题的解决方法当你在Linux终端中尝试查看Python的版本时,输入python...

在Python中如何高效地将一个DataFrame的整列复制到另一个结构不同的DataFrame中? 在Python中如何高效地将一个DataFrame的整列复制到另一个结构不同的DataFrame中? Apr 01, 2025 pm 11:15 PM

在使用Python的pandas库时,如何在两个结构不同的DataFrame之间进行整列复制是一个常见的问题。假设我们有两个Dat...

Python沙漏图形绘制:如何避免变量未定义错误? Python沙漏图形绘制:如何避免变量未定义错误? Apr 01, 2025 pm 06:27 PM

Python入门:沙漏图形绘制及输入校验本文将解决一个Python新手在沙漏图形绘制程序中遇到的变量定义问题。代码...

Python脚本如何在特定位置清空输出到光标位置? Python脚本如何在特定位置清空输出到光标位置? Apr 01, 2025 pm 11:30 PM

Python脚本如何在特定位置清空输出到光标位置?在编写Python脚本时,如何清空之前的输出到光标位置是个常见的...

Python跨平台桌面应用开发:哪个GUI库最适合你? Python跨平台桌面应用开发:哪个GUI库最适合你? Apr 01, 2025 pm 05:24 PM

Python跨平台桌面应用开发库的选择许多Python开发者都希望开发出能够在Windows和Linux系统上都能运行的桌面应用程...

Python参数注解可以使用字符串吗? Python参数注解可以使用字符串吗? Apr 01, 2025 pm 08:39 PM

Python参数注解的另类用法在Python编程中,参数注解是一种非常有用的功能,可以帮助开发者更好地理解和使用函...

Python中如何通过字符串动态创建对象并调用其方法? Python中如何通过字符串动态创建对象并调用其方法? Apr 01, 2025 pm 11:18 PM

在Python中,如何通过字符串动态创建对象并调用其方法?这是一个常见的编程需求,尤其在需要根据配置或运行...

Google和AWS是否提供公共PyPI镜像源? Google和AWS是否提供公共PyPI镜像源? Apr 01, 2025 pm 05:15 PM

云服务商提供的PyPI镜像源许多开发者依赖PyPI(PythonPackageIndex)...

See all articles